![]() if your spell gems bar has the book icon at the bottom...right click the book icon..if you see save spell set you're good....providing it actually saves, if it does you would see "load spell set xxxx" on right clicking the icon.
if you don't have the spell bar with the icon, can likely find a working one at eqinterface. Pherhaps not classic, but, definately convienient with the many many classic deaths! | ||
